Tag: android gridview

用UIL显示图像的Pinterest风格

Pinterest显示图像的风格非常出色,这为您的应用增添了美感。 经过几次研究后,我发现有很好的库可以显示像Pinterest这样的图像,但不确定它是否与UIL兼容。 我正在使用Universal-Image-Loader来显示我的图像。 在下面显示的图像中,我以这种方式显示了我的图像,并带有一些视图。 无可否认,UIL库在显示大量图像时极大地处理了手机内存。 我想知道是否有可能像Pinterest那样显示我的图像,但仍然使用UIL作为生成器。 这种方法有什么可能的解决方案? 或者也许是另一个只处理显示并与UIL兼容的库 。 更新: 我尝试使用StaggeredGridView,但布局无法转换为GridView 。

数组适配器从Res文件夹加载图像(Android应用程序)

我是一个Android新手。 我试图通过数组适配器将我的res / Drawable文件夹中的一堆图像加载到Gridview中。 不幸的是,我每次尝试使用gridView查看活动时都会崩溃。 我想知道如何设置我在res文件夹中的图像的imageResource以显示在Gridview中。 这是我的代码: Smile.class public class Smiley extends Activity { GridView gridView;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.smile); gridView = (GridView) findViewById(R.id.gridView1); String planets[] = this.getResources().getStringArray(R.array.imageme); ArrayAdapteradapter = new ArrayAdapter (this,R.layout.grid_view_row,R.id.imageGrid , planets); gridView.setAdapter(adapter); } } Smile.xml grid_view_row.xml(Gridview的自定义布局) 我的字符串数组(xml) @drawable/a @drawable/b @drawable/c @drawable/d logcat的 09-04 16:48:40.561: E/ArrayAdapter(25938): You must […]

如何动态添加图像到GridView?

我有一个基于项目数组创建的GridView 。 当网格滚动到底部时,我需要添加更多图像,但我不知道该怎么做。 现在我明白了以下几点: 我有一个适配器,它解析数组并将ImageIds提供给将返回ImageViews的类 不知何故,我必须更改此数组并让适配器知道它,所以我的问题是,如何获得对此适配器的引用? 这是我的代码: package com.wm.grid; import android.app.Activity; import android.content.Context; import android.os.Bundle; import android.view.LayoutInflater; import android.view.View; import android.widget.AbsListView; import android.widget.AbsListView.OnScrollListener; import android.widget.AdapterView; import android.widget.AdapterView.OnItemClickListener; import android.widget.GridView; import android.widget.ImageView; import android.widget.LinearLayout; import android.widget.ListAdapter; import android.widget.Toast; public class GridActivity extends Activity { /** Called when the activity is first created. */ @Override public void […]